What Sparked the Sell-Off?

  • Geopolitical Uncertainty: Heightened fears stemming from developments in the Middle East have pushed risk-off sentiment among crypto investors, quickly translating into selling pressure.
  • Forced Liquidations: As Bitcoin plunged below $100K, leveraged positions were liquidated, exacerbating the downward price movement and partially wiping out over $1B in value.
  • Market Volatility: The precarious balance between bulls and bears, alongside strategic moves by whales, has intensified the tension around the $97K–$102K support zone.

Forecasts and Future Outlook

Market analysts warn that Bitcoin’s next move is critical. If the bearish momentum continues and the price dips further beneath the $97K threshold, it could not only deepen the current $1B liquidation scare but also lead to extended market corrections. Conversely, if buyers find strength at the support zone between $97K and $102K, we may see a consolidation phase with potential signs of recovery. Traders are encouraged to monitor key indicators such as volume spikes, trading sentiment, and emerging global events that could sway the market direction.
